Has anyone used a continuous glucose monitor for their diabetic cat? My cat, diabetic and insulin dependent, for one year, has had some unexplained low blood sugar levels recently. He got a continuous blood glucose monitor placed that works for two weeks. I was just wondering if anyone else had used this?
